Overview
Are you an animal lover looking for an ethical animal welfare volunteering program abroad? We offer affordable and meaningful Animal Welfare programs where you’ll work closely with animals and professional veterinarians, contributing to their wellbeing.
As an Animal Welfare volunteer, you’ll be placed with a local veterinarian, treating animals such as donkeys, dogs, cats, chickens, and cows. You will work at a small clinic, a shelter, and travel with the vet to farms and villages, gaining exposure to animal diseases and treatments.

Program Details
What you’ll do:
- Assist the local vet with treatments and procedures
- Help with vaccinations, neutering, and wound care
- Support feeding, walking, and care at the shelter
- Travel to farms and villages with the vet (where applicable)
- Prepare animals for adoption and support shelter operations
US $100 is donated to the local vet for logistics and supervision. You will gain hands-on experience and learn about animal welfare in Tanzania.

Location
All projects are based in and around Arusha, Tanzania—the gateway to Mount Kilimanjaro and many national parks. Arusha is a vibrant city where you will experience Tanzanian culture while contributing to meaningful community and conservation work.
